Top Wynford spellers

After 23 rounds in the Wynford Elementary School spelling bee, the top spellers were (from left) Marty Schuster, Jack Gatchel and Drew Johnson. All three students will attend the Crawford County Spelling Bee at 7 p.m. Thursday at William Crawford Intermediate School, Crestline, and Marty also will represent Wynford Elementary in the Scripps National Spelling Bee this month.

Adopt a youth for Easter

Registration for the Upper Sandusky Rotary Club’s annual Good Eggs for Easter program will take place from Friday through Feb. 10. Forms will be available at the Wyandot County Department of Job and Family Services, which will collect names of children in need or those who are at-risk.

F-J Library closed Mon.

FOREST — The Forest-Jackson Public Library will be closed Monday in observance of Martin Luther King Jr. Day. The library’s card catalogue is available 24 hours per day, seven days a week at www.forestlibrary.org.
